Usability Study of Button Size and Spacing in VR Audiovisual Media Interfaces

Overview

Randomized trial assesses how button size and spacing affect usability in VR media interfaces, suggesting design improvements.

Key Points

  • This study aims to evaluate the impact of button size and spacing on user performance and perceptions in VR interfaces.
  • Conducted a 2x3 factorial experiment with 72 participants to test different button sizes and spacings.
  • Collected performance metrics and subjective feedback using a two-factor analysis of variance (ANOVA).
  • Analyzed task completion times and subjective preferences in relation to Fitts' Law.
  • Small spacing resulted in quicker task completion times, supporting Fitts' Law.
  • Large button sizes did not yield significant performance effects, indicating potential issues with target size saturation.
  • Medium spacing was preferred over small spacing, and highest preference was noted for specific size and spacing combinations.
